Why gravitational potential is negative?

Gravitational potential is considered negative because work needs to be done to move an object from an infinite distance to a certain point in the gravitational field. As the object moves closer to a massive body, the potential energy decreases, resulting in a negative value to reflect the work done against the gravitational force.

Why is the potential energy of two like charges positive and two unlike charges negative?

The potential energy of two like charges is positive because work must be done to bring them together against their natural repulsion. Conversely, the potential energy of two unlike charges is negative because work is released when they come together and move into a lower potential energy state.

What is the meaning of the phase forwarned is forearmed?

This phrase means that being informed or prepared in advance can help protect oneself against potential dangers or difficulties. By being aware of possible risks or challenges, one can take steps to prevent negative outcomes or minimize their impact.
